Low-Carb Weight Loss for Non-Meat Eaters: Tips & Strategies


Question
Joseph
I am 46,220 lbs.,pretty good shape cardio wise but at least 30 lbs over weight.
I have always kept my calorie intake down,as I have a sluggish metabolism.It has improved somewhat with regular cardio.
Just recently I started cutting out the carbs and am starting to lose weight.Problem is I am not a big meat eater and was raised on bread,potatoes,etc.
I cant live on meat and veggies much longer.Any suggestions?


Answer
Hi Joseph
My wife had a similar problem. Her favorites are rice , pasta and potatoes.

She always said "I can't eat that much meat"

The key to getting her into a more balanced diet was including the meat in dishes that were previously more starches. In other words...not meat by itself.

Find a meat that you like and cook it in a wide variety of ways. Without knowing what you like I can't be more specific
